Strategic Marketing and International Business Strategy Module Details
Module/Course Description
Course Title: Strategic Marketing and International Business Strategy
Course Code: UU-BBA-2301-UG
Programme: Bachelor of Arts in Business Administration - BL
Credits: 4.00
Course Description:
Course/Module Description:
This module provides an insight towards the unique aspects of strategic marketing in the international business environment and provides the framework upon which multinational marketing management can be based. It will give the students the perspective on the decision making process in the areas of foreign market analysis, target identification, product planning, promotion and channels of distribution, strategy identification and formulation.
Course/Module Objectives:
The main objectives of the course are:
- To provide an understanding of the concepts of strategic marketing and the ability to apply these to a variety of organizations
- To examine how a thorough understanding and analysis of an organization and its environment can lead to the development of appropriate marketing objectives and strategies
- To explore numerous techniques for segmenting foreign markets
- To provide knowledge for investing in International markets while designing competitive strategies
Course/Module Learning Outcomes:
After completion of the course students are expected to be able:
- To identify the basic principles of marketing that can be applied in a variety of diverse cultural, political, legal and economic environments
- To identify the benefits that nations derive from unrestrained free trade
- To analyze various methods of entering foreign markets, the degree of commitment required and the associated levels of risk
- To appraise the concepts of product life cycle and classification of goods and their importance for foreign market acceptance, product adaptation and overall marketing strategy decision making
- To explain the various techniques used by modern marketers for segmenting foreign markets in both the consumer and industrial sectors
